GL Garrad Hassan Creates 'Global Award in Renewable Energy' (Germany)

GL Garrad Hassan has created the “Global Award in Renewable Energy”. The award will honour innovative ideas and new technical approaches in research and development for the renewable energy industry.

The award is created to spur young scientists to take up the challenge of answering questions like: How can the cost of renewable energy projects be reduced? What can be done to minimise transport losses, so that more of the energy generated by offshore wind energy plants reaches consumers? Where are the opportunities for wind turbines to be made even more efficient?

The “GL Garrad Hassan Global Award in Renewable Energy” will be presented for a PhD thesis which best embodies this year’s theme: “Innovation and cost saving”. The winner will be awarded a cash prize of €5,000.

Submissions must be received by 30 November 2012. The winner will be notified at the end of January 2013.
